A project manager is evaluating earned value metrics for a project. The CPI is 0.8 and the SPI is 0.9. Which TWO conclusions can the project manager draw?

The project is behind schedule

CPI < 1 indicates over budget; SPI < 1 indicates behind schedule.

  • The project is ahead of schedule

    Why it's wrong here

    SPI < 1 means EV < PV, indicating behind schedule.

  • The project is behind schedule

    Why this is correct

    Correct: SPI < 1 means schedule efficiency is less than planned.

  • The project is under budget

    Why it's wrong here

    CPI < 1 indicates over budget, not under.

  • The project is over budget

    Why this is correct

    Correct: CPI < 1 means EV < AC, indicating cost overrun.

  • The project is on schedule

    Why it's wrong here

    SPI of 0.9 indicates behind schedule.
